Google Business Profile Dominance
This feature involves a complete audit and strategic optimization of your Google Business Profile (GBP), which is the cornerstone of local search visibility. The process includes selecting the most effective business categories, managing professional photos and posts, actively responding to Q&A, and implementing a proactive review strategy. The goal is to maximize every element of your GBP to improve rankings in the local pack, enhance click-through rates, and convert profile viewers into direct phone calls and quote requests.
Local Citation Building & Cleanup
Mover Marketing AI builds and verifies your business citations across 50+ authoritative online directories specific to the moving industry and local search. This service ensures your business Name, Address, and Phone number (NAP) are perfectly consistent everywhere, which is a critical trust signal to search engines. By cleaning up existing inconsistencies and establishing new, high-authority citations, this feature directly boosts your local search ranking power and online authority.
Targeted Service Area Page Strategy
The platform develops custom, SEO-optimized landing pages for each primary city and neighborhood within your service area. Each page is tailored to target specific location-based keywords (e.g., "movers in Denver" or "packing services in Capitol Hill") that potential customers are actively searching for. This strategic content creation helps you capture valuable search traffic from surrounding areas, expanding your digital footprint and attracting highly qualified local leads.
Automated Review Generation System
This feature implements automated workflows to systematically solicit 5-star reviews from satisfied customers directly on your Google Business Profile. A steady stream of positive reviews is one of the most powerful local ranking factors and serves as critical social proof for new customers. By turning happy clients into a consistent source of ranking signals, this system builds trust, improves visibility, and directly influences a searcher's decision to choose your company over competitors.

How long does it take to rank in the Google Map Pack?
Most moving companies begin to see significant improvements in their map pack visibility within 2 to 4 months of starting service. The exact timeline depends on factors such as the current health of your Google Business Profile, the level of competition in your market, and your city's size. We prioritize "quick win" optimizations to your GBP that can yield noticeable results within the first few weeks, while longer-term strategies like citation building and authority growth solidify your rankings over subsequent months.
Do I need a physical office or storefront to rank in local search?
No, you do not need a physical storefront. Many moving companies operate successfully as Google-defined Service Area Businesses (SABs). We specialize in optimizing SAB profiles, which allows you to hide your business address while still appearing prominently in local search results for the areas you serve. Our entire strategy is tailored to maximize visibility for businesses that operate in this model.
How many service area pages does my moving company need?
The number of service area pages required depends entirely on the geographic scope of your operations. We typically recommend creating dedicated, optimized pages for each primary city and major neighborhood you serve. For a local moving company, this often means 10-30 pages. For regional movers covering a wider area, a strategy involving 50 or more targeted location pages is common to capture search traffic effectively across all territories.
What are the most important directories for moving company citations?
The single most important directory is your Google Business Profile. Beyond that, we focus on building citations on high-authority platforms that are relevant to local services and the moving industry specifically. This core list includes Yelp, Better Business Bureau (BBB), Angi, HomeAdvisor, MovingCompanyReviews.com, and over 40 other directories that search engines trust for local business information, ensuring maximum impact on your local search authority.
